**Vendor note: Inkmill markdown pipeline**

Rendering for Parchway docs is outsourced to Inkmill under an annual contract, renewing each March. They handle sanitization and PDF export; we own the upload queue. SLA: 4-hour response on rendering failures. Escalate only after two failed retries. Their support desk is reachable at the address below.

billing contact of hahaf-baguf = zorael.tammir.jorius@sivrelhq.internal

Step 4: Migrating the Lexiphran string-extraction script. Before running the extractor against the Orvalle locale repository, verify that the sandbox profile restricts filesystem access to the catalog directory only. The script shells out to no external tools in version 3, which removes the prior injection surface flagged in the Quorrin audit. The service reads the following configuration values at startup.

deployment values, kajep-kageg:
[praix]
host = praix.paliqcorp.corp
user = praix_svc
database = praix_prod

Nice catch on the export retry loop — but please don't hardcode your own backoff in the plugin. Exportify's host already retries failed exports with jittered exponential backoff, and stacking your retries on top of ours hammers the target store. Just throw `ExportTransientError` and let the host handle it. For reference, the host uses these constants.

tuning constants:
QUOTAS = {
    "druwyn": 5,
    "holix": 5,
    "zorath": 5,
    "holwyn": 10,
}

For the incoming director. Attendees: commercial, finance, and product leads; chaired by Arno Delquist.

Current Kestrel Series pricing was reviewed against competitor benchmarks in the Valmere market. Decision: raise the mid-tier price by 5% and bundle the maintenance add-on at no charge for the first year. Entry tier unchanged. Finance confirmed the move is margin-neutral in year one, accretive after. Rollout begins next quarter; channel partners get 60 days' notice. Further strategic context for these decisions appears below.

board note of bawep-tajef: Queniusek Systems plans to raise the Quenvan list price by 53.1 percent in March. The pricing group signed off on a budget of $176.4 million for Project Drueth. The renewal with Casionix Partners closes at $142.5 million a year, 8.3 percent below the last contract. Project Fraax slips by six weeks because of the tooling delay.